Crynodeb

You will be the administrative lead for participating RAF students on HE schemes, specifically:
You will be responsible for the administration of Advanced Pre-Employment Training (APET) and Advanced Professional Military Development (Higher Education) (APMD (HE)). APET posts require specific knowledge/skills that require attendance at university before posting into the role. Working with Career Managers, requirement owners, students, Defence Academy and universities, you will capture all activity to ensure students have completed their studies in time for posting into the APET role.
You will be responsible for supporting the administration of the Executive Masters Degree scheme. This will include managing students throughout their part-time studies, preparing documentation for the RAF selection Board and regular liaison with students, Career Management, Professions Advisors, Defence Academy and Cranfield University. You will also be responsible for maintaining the master spreadsheet of activity.
Other activity related to the post may include participation in the selection of courses for the tri-Service prospectus which you will be responsible for, day to day administration of RAF and Civil Service students via the DLE, selection of students, issuing joining instructions and RAF point of contact for any participating universities.
You will support the Assurance Visit process when required by carrying out a 10% check of learning credits via e-Dossier, attending the location as part of the visiting team, liaising with the appropriate staff to clarify any points raised as a result of your check and covering elements of the report process for and on behalf of the author.
You will provide cover for the Learning Credits Administrator in times of absence, dealing with RAF Veterans who wish to utilise Enhanced Learning Credits. Working with the individual, Enhanced Learning Credits Administration Service and TSLD you will process applications in accordance with the current policy. Further, cover for the Military Aviation Academy Scheme Administrator during times of absence. This will include admin tasks related to student registrations and providing management information for upward reporting.
You may also be responsible for supporting aspects of contract activity, annual costing and associated financial activity using the Contracting, Purchasing and Finance (CP&F) system, including data gathering during contract periods and supporting the production of the annual contract monitoring report.
